• *ALUMINUM WELDER JOB DESCRIPTION**

Milron specializes in designing, fabricating, and assembling aluminum service bodies for commercial vehicles. We are committed to delivering high-quality products that meet the needs and specifications of our clients.

With a strong emphasis on attention to detail and commitment to delivering exceptional quality, we are dedicated to meeting the unique needs of our customers through innovative aluminum welding techniques.

As a Welder, you will play a vital role in ensuring the structural integrity and exceptional quality of our aluminum truck bodies. The successful candidate will have developed welding skills with a proficiency in aluminum welding, and a keen eye for detail.
• *Responsibilities:
• Perform aluminum welding tasks with precision and accuracy, following job specifications, blueprints, and welding codes.
• Set up and operate welding equipment, selecting appropriate materials, and adjusting parameters to achieve optimal welding results.
• Read and interpret technical drawings, blueprints, and welding symbols to determine welding requirements for aluminum truck bodies.
• Prepare workpieces by cleaning, deburring, and inspecting surfaces to ensure they are free from contaminants and defects.
• Position and secure workpieces using clamps, fixtures, or other holding devices to facilitate the welding process.
• Utilize various welding techniques, including MIG, TIG, and oxy-acetylene welding, to join aluminum components effectively.
• Monitor welding processes to ensure proper fusion, penetration, and heat control, while maintaining high-quality standards.
• Conduct visual inspections of welded joints to identify and address defects such as cracks, porosity, and incomplete welds.
• Perform post-welding activities, including grinding, polishing, and cleaning, to achieve a finished appearance that meets quality specifications.
• Collaborate with other team members and supervisors to meet production goals and maintain a safe working environment.
• Follow established safety guidelines and procedures to prevent accidents, injuries, and damage to equipment.
• Perform regular maintenance, troubleshooting, and repairs on welding equipment to ensure optimal functionality.
